Real estate prices Cauterets

In Cauterets, apartments sell at a median €3,590 per square metre, with 167 sales in twelve months.

The Cauterets market is read here from the DGFiP record of actual sales, not from asking prices. Apartments carry the local market with 158 sales over twelve months, against 9 houses. Over the last twelve months the median moved by +0.9 %. That amounts to stability.

What the sales show in Cauterets

The median apartment price in Cauterets stands at €3,590 per square metre. Houses come out at €3,573.

Half of apartment sales in Cauterets fall between €2,929 and €4,142 per square metre. That gap owes more to condition than to opposing neighbourhoods: this market does not split into starkly different price zones.

The average apartment sold in Cauterets covers 36 square metres, putting a typical transaction near €129,217. That is an order of magnitude drawn from averages, not the valuation of any particular property.

Prices by property type in Cauterets

Property typeMedian price / sq.mp25-p75 rangeAverage surfaceSales 12 months
Studio€3,275€2,903 – €4,00126 m²42
T2€3,587€3,090 – €4,11235 m²55
T3€3,737€2,938 – €4,32545 m²39
T4€3,771€2,805 – €4,29271 m²12
House€3,573€2,472 – €4,57393 m²9

Prices by property type in Cauterets

By property type in Cauterets: T2 at €3,587/m², studio at €3,275/m², T3 at €3,737/m², T4 at €3,771/m².

The T4 carries the highest price per square metre and the studio the lowest, a gap of 15 %. Small units usually cost more per square metre than large ones, because the price of a kitchen and a bathroom is spread over fewer metres.

The T2 is what changes hands most often here, with 55 sales over twelve months. It is therefore the type with the most reference points, and the one where a price is hardest to argue against.

Buying in Cauterets

Reading the €2,929 to €4,142 band is a buyer’s main tool in Cauterets. A property at the bottom is not a bargain and one at the top is not a rip-off: the band measures how different the properties are, not how well they are priced.

A stable market usually means a negotiation decided by the property itself rather than by any general trend.

Acquisition costs are budgeted on top of the price: around 8 % on an existing property, around 3 % on a new one. These are orders of magnitude; the notary computes the exact amount.
